NASA Sets April 1 Moon Mission Launch
NASA has set April 1 for the Artemis II launch. Four astronauts will fly on this mission.
It will be the first crewed moon mission in over 50 years. The last crewed moon mission was Apollo 17 in 1972.
Artemis II will orbit the moon, not land. A 6-day launch window opens from Kennedy Space Center in Florida, United States.
NASA postponed Artemis II twice, in February and March. NASA says rocket problems that caused those delays are now fixed.
